Academic code of conduct is a set of rules and guidelines that outline the expected behavior and ethical standards for students and faculty members in an academic setting.
All students and faculty members are required to adhere to and file academic code of conduct.
Academic code of conduct can be filled out by reviewing the guidelines and rules provided and signing the document to acknowledge understanding and agreement.
The purpose of academic code of conduct is to maintain integrity, honesty, and fairness in academic environments, as well as to ensure academic excellence and uphold institutional values.
Academic code of conduct typically requires reporting any instances of cheating, plagiarism, dishonest behavior, or violations of academic integrity.
